Alnwick/Haldimand Township 2026 Budget Survey Released

In City Hall, Local

Township of Alnwick/Haldimand is pleased to release the 2026 budget survey. Residents are invited to provide their input on the current and future funding of services and programs. This community input will be reviewed by staff and Council during the development of the 2026 Budget to help prioritize spending and projects for the upcoming year.

Residents are encouraged to engage by completing the 2026 budget survey available online at www.ahtwp.ca/communityengagement.

Hard copies of the survey are available at the Grafton Municipal Office, and Centreton, Grafton, and Roseneath Public Libraries.

The deadline to complete the survey is October 26, 2025.
